Design and Build Quality

Smeg SMF03BLU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

With a fully painted gloss body, this stand mixer is built around a retro-styled aluminium casing designed to suit everyday kitchen use. The construction feels solid, and the enamelled look helps it blend into colourful kitchen counters. A high polished stainless steel 4.8L mixing bowl sits securely in the frame and it works with the included wire whisk for early tasks. At the front, an attachment port allows swapping accessories such as a flat beater or dough hook. The overall design is clean but remains bulky.

Smeg SMF03PBU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

With its Italian retro style, the Smeg is designed as a visible centrepiece. It has a fully painted gloss body, and the exterior is described as aluminium, plastic, and stainless steel, helping keep the finish sturdy while maintaining a smooth, enamelled appearance. The 4.8L high polished stainless steel bowl sits securely on the base, and it comes with three tools: a dough hook, flat beater, and whisk. A front attachment port supports swapping accessories. The gloss surface needs careful wiping to prevent marks.

Motor Power and Performance for Heavy Mixes

Smeg SMF03BLU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

Even as it targets everyday baking and mixing, the Smeg's motor setup is designed for tougher jobs, using an 800 W direct drive motor and a controlled planetary action that supports dual beating and whisking. Performance stays practical rather than flashy: the mixer uses ten variable speed settings, with a soft start to help reduce sudden movement. For heavy mixes, this gives steady mixing when combining ingredients that need more than whisking, while the planetary motion keeps beaters moving evenly. Results still depend on correct speed choice and attachment fit.

Smeg SMF03PBU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

For heavy mixes, the stand mixer uses an 800 W direct drive motor, with controlled planetary beating and whisking providing a dual mixing action. Performance is linked to that planetary movement, which helps keep ingredients moving through the bowl during thick mixes. It offers 10 variable speeds, controlled by a top lever with a soft start for steadier start-up before increasing power. Higher speeds suit denser dough work, while lower settings help combine ingredients without splashing. The mixing action is consistent, although results depend on choosing the correct accessory.

Attachments and Versatility

Smeg SMF03BLU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

With its front attachment port, the Smeg SMF03BLUK stand mixer can swap tools to suit different tasks, rather than relying only on the wire whisk included in the box. Versatility comes from using optional attachments such as a flat beater, dough hook, and plastic bowl cover. For cakes, the wire whisk supports beating and whisking, the flat beater suits thicker mixes, and the dough hook targets kneading. Attachments connect at the port, and mixing takes place in the 4.8 L stainless steel bowl. Only the wire whisk is provided, so the other attachments must be purchased separately.

Smeg SMF03PBUK Full Colour Stand Mixer

With a front attachment port, the Smeg supports swapping accessories for different tasks, with the included set covering most daily baking needs. The mixer is supplied with a dough hook, flat beater, beater and whisk, enabling it to handle doughs, batters and whipped mixtures. The 4.8 litre polished bowl suits larger batches, while the footprint of 22.1D x 40.5W x 49H cm matters for kitchen space planning. Stand mixer versatility therefore depends on how many additional attachments are sourced beyond the included tools.
